Advanced Energy Storage: What''s the Value of Frequency Regulation?

In contrast, advanced energy storage systems are ideally suited for providing frequency regulation services. Since the ACE represents the short-term fluctuations in supply and demand, it is by-and-large energy neutral—over a measureable amount of time, an asset providing regulation service neither generates nor consumes energy. How Battery-Based Energy Storage Systems Will Enable

Successfully Regulating Frequency Success stories of energy storage regulating frequency already exist across the world, dating back a decade. In 2012, Chile installed a 20 MW system owned and operated by AES Gener that took over frequency regulation for a spinning reserve turbine, providing a more effective solution for grid stability.

Service stacking using energy storage systems for grid

Some services are more uncertain, take frequency regulation services as an example. Storage units that have been purchased to be stand-by for one or more frequency regulation services do most probably not get activated several hours in the same day due to large frequency deviations.
